Let I denote the `3xx3` and P be a matrix obtained by rearranging the columns of I. Then

A

1) there are six distinct choices for P and det (P) = 1

B

2) there are six distinct choices for P and det(P)=`+-1`

C

3) there are more than one choices for P and some of them are not invertible.

D

4) there are more than one choices for P and `P^-1` = I in each choice.
